html{height:100%;margin-bottom:1px}
body{line-height:125%;font-family:"Lucida Grande", Tahoma, Helvetica, sans-serif;color:#555;font-size:12px;margin:0;padding:0}
.auto{margin:0 auto}
#page_bg{height:100%;margin-bottom:1px;background:#696969 url(images/bg.png) repeat;padding:0}
.wrapper{position:relative;width:1000px;margin:0 auto}
#shadow-l{background:url(images/shadow-l.png) 0 0 repeat-y;padding-left:6px;position:relative}
#shadow-r{background:url(images/shadow-r.png) 100% 0 repeat-y;padding-right:6px;position:relative}
#mainbody{background:#fff;margin:0;padding:0 5px}
#body_main{overflow:hidden;padding:4px 8px 0}
p{margin-top:0;margin-bottom:5px}
.adboast{padding-bottom:12px}
.adboast:after{content:"...";color:#aaa}
.ad728,.ad336{padding:0 0 25px}
.ad728{width:730px}
.ad336{padding: 15px 30px;}
.nav{font-size:93%;margin-bottom:2px}
a img{border:0}
.quote{color:#666;background:url(images/web-23.png) repeat-x scroll center top #e1e1e1;border:1px solid #D1D1D1;font-size:x-small;line-height:1.4em;margin:2px;padding:4px}
.code{color:#000;background-color:#EBFFD7;font-family:"courier new", "times new roman", monospace;font-size:x-small;line-height:1.3em;border:1px solid #000;width:99%;white-space:nowrap;overflow:auto;max-height:24em;margin:1px auto;padding:1px}
.quoteheader,.codeheader{color:#000;text-decoration:none;font-style:normal;font-weight:700;font-size:x-small;line-height:1.2em}
.help{cursor:help}
.editor{width:96%}
.highlight{background-color:#FF0;font-weight:700;color:#000}
.windowbg,tr.windowbg td{background:#EEE;border-bottom:1px solid #eee;padding:5px}
.windowbg2,tr.windowbg2 td{background:#fcfcfc;border-bottom:1px solid #eee;padding:5px}
.windowbg3,tr.windowbg3 td{background:#f0f0f0;padding:5px}
table.nopad .titlebg,tr.titlebg th,tr.titlebg td,.titlebg2,tr.titlebg2 th,tr.titlebg2 td,tr td.titlebg{font-size:100%;font-weight:700;padding:4px}
.titlebg,.titlebg2{background:#DDD}
#top_subject{width:85%;padding-left:6px;text-align:right}
h1.topic_title{line-height:1;background:url(images/post/xx.gif) 1px 8px no-repeat;font-weight:400;margin-bottom:8px;padding:5px 0 0 26px}
.topic_desc{font-size:110%;padding-bottom:10px;color:#9f9f9f}
.p_author,.p_time{padding-left:14px;margin-left:2px;background-image:url(images/sprites.png);background-repeat:no-repeat}
.p_author{background-position:1px -24px}
.p_time{background-position:-1px -86px}
.bordercolor{border:1px solid #CCC}
.tborder{border:1px solid #CCC;padding:1px}
.catbg,.catbg2,.catbg3{background:#efefef url(images/cat-bg.png) 0 -10px repeat-x;border-bottom:2px solid #CCC}
.smalltext{font-size:x-small;font-family:verdana, sans-serif}
.middletext{line-height:18px;text-indent:10px}
.normaltext{font-size:small}
.largetext{font-size:large}
.post,.personalmessage{width:100%;overflow:auto;line-height:1.3em}
.signature{width:100%;overflow:auto;padding-bottom:3px;line-height:1.3em}
.error{color:red}
#header{position:relative;height:111px;overflow:hidden;background:#232833 url(images/header-bg.png) repeat-x}
#header-l{height:111px;background:url(images/header-l.png) 0 0 no-repeat;position:relative;padding-left:16px}
#header-r{height:111px;background:url(images/header-r.png) 100% 0 no-repeat;position:relative;padding-right:16px}
#logo-bg,#logo-bg a{position:absolute;top:0;left:0;display:block;width:440px;height:111px;background:url(images/logo-bg.png) no-repeat;color:#999;font-family:Arial, Helvetica, sans-serif;font-size:24px;line-height:24px;font-weight:700;padding:30px 0 0 30px}
#logo,#logo a{position:absolute;top:0;left:0;display:block;width:440px;height:111px;background:url(images/logo.png) no-repeat;color:#999;font-family:Arial, Helvetica, sans-serif;font-size:24px;line-height:24px;font-weight:700;padding:30px 0 0 30px}
#news{height:100px;padding-top:15px;overflow:hidden;margin-left:485px;margin-bottom:10px;margin-right:0;color:#999;font-size:x-small;position:relative}
#useropts{list-style:none;margin:0 50px 0 0;padding:0}
.avatar_t{height:65px;width:65px;border:none}
.avatar{overflow: hidden; width: 100%}
div.profile_info{margin-left:80px}
td.smalltext{font-weight:400}
#toolbar{height:28px;background:url(images/toolbar-bg.png) repeat-x;position:relative;margin:0;padding:0}
#nav{height:26px;background:url(images/toolbar-div.png) 0 0 no-repeat;font-size:10px;margin:0 0 0 20px;padding:0}
#nav ul{margin:0;padding:0}
#nav li{float:left;display:block;background:url(images/toolbar-div.png) 100% 0 no-repeat;margin:0;padding:0}
#nav a{text-decoration:none;cursor:pointer;font-weight:700}
#nav li a{display:block;float:left;height:26px;line-height:26px;color:#999;padding:0 10px}
#nav a:hover{color:#eee;background:#F4B12C url(images/hover-bg.png) 0 0 repeat-x}
#nav a:active{color:#333}
#showcase{background:#fff;color:#444;margin:0;padding:0}
#showcase li{border-bottom:1px dotted #b7bbc7;padding-bottom:0;margin-bottom:2px}
.userinfo{background:#fff url(images/showcase-bgl.png) 100% 0 no-repeat;width:350px;float:left;padding:10px 0 10px 10px}
.searchfield{background:#fff;text-align:right;padding:15px 20px 10px 5px}
#search_form{position:absolute;right:5px;bottom:15px}
#search_form input{border:none;transition:.4s all ease-in-out;-moz-transition:.4s all ease-in-out;-webkit-transition:.4s all ease-in-out;-o-transition:.4s all ease-in-out}
#search_form input[type=submit]{background:url(images/sprites.png) no-repeat 0 -50px;color:#FF9239!important;font-size:0;height:20px;cursor:pointer;width:20px}
#search_form input[type=submit]:hover{background-position:0 -70px}
#search_form input[type=text]{color:#999;background:none;font-size:120%;width:125px;padding:2px 6px}
#search_form input[type=text]:focus{width:210px}
#search_form > div{border:1px solid #EEE;border-radius:8px;-webkit-border-radius:8px;-moz-border-radius:8px;box-shadow:0 0 11px #EEE inset;padding:2px 2px 0}
#footer{background:url(images/footer-bg.png) repeat-x;height:83px;color:#eee;text-align:center;margin:0;padding:35px 0 0 10px}
#footer-l{background:url(images/footer-bgl.png) 0 0 no-repeat;height:83px;padding-left:251px}
#footer-r{background:url(images/footer-bgr.png) 100% 0 no-repeat;height:83px;padding-right:49px}
#footer a{color:#fff}
#footer2{text-align:right;color:#999;margin:0 30px 10px 0}
#footer2 a{color:#999}
span.pathway{display:block;height:30px;line-height:16px;vertical-align:middle;margin-top:5px;margin-bottom:10px}
span.pathway img{vertical-align:middle;margin:0 2px}
div#pathway{margin-bottom:10px;padding-left:8px}
fieldset{border:0;padding:5px 0}
a{color:#E57718}
a:hover{color:#000;text-decoration:none}
.small,.modifydate,.createdate,div.mosimage_caption{font-size:100%}
#nav a,#inset a{font-size:110%}
#nav,span.pathway,.small,.createdate,.modifydate,#inset{font-family:Arial, Helvetica, sans-serif;font-weight:700}
a:link,a:visited{text-decoration:none}
h1,h2,h3,h4{padding-bottom:5px;color:#888;font-family:"Trebuchet MS", Helvetica, sans-serif}
.small{font-weight:700;color:#999}
.modifydate{height:20px;vertical-align:bottom;font-weight:700;color:#999}
.createdate{height:20px;font-weight:700;vertical-align:top;padding-bottom:5px;padding-top:0;color:#999}
form{border:0;margin:0;padding:0}
.sitemap{list-style:none;margin:0;padding:0}
.sitemap_topheader{background:#ECEDF3;border-bottom:solid 1px #fff;padding:4px}
.sitemap_header{background:#ECEDF3;border-bottom:solid 1px #fff;display:block;font-weight:700;padding:4px}
.sitemap_header_active{background:#C8D6E1;border-bottom:solid 1px #fff;display:block;font-weight:700;padding:4px}
.sitemap_header:hover,.sitemap_header_active:hover{background:#DBE4ED;border-bottom:solid 1px #fff;display:block;text-decoration:none;padding:4px}
ul#articlelist{list-style:none;margin:0;padding:.5ex 0}
ul#catlist{list-style:none;border-top:solid 1px #d0d0d0;margin:0;padding:0}
ul#articlelist li{display:block;background:url(images/divider.gif) no-repeat 5px 3px;margin:0;padding:0 0 0 3ex}
ul#catlist li{display:block;margin:0;padding:0 0 0 3ex}
.rss_title{font-weight:700;margin-left:5px}
.rss_body{margin-bottom:1ex}
.rss_image{margin:4px 0}
.social{border-top:1px solid #D2D2D2;border-bottom:1px solid #D2D2D2;background:#EAEAEA;margin:6px 0;width: 610px; display:inline-block}
.rt{float:right;text-align:right}
#ajax_in_progress{background:#32CD32;color:#FFF;text-align:center;font-weight:700;font-size:18pt;width:100%;position:fixed;top:0;left:0;padding:3px}
.vob_protected{cursor:default}
.vob_protected,.vob_protected a:link,.vob_protected a:visited,.vob_protected a:hover{color:red;text-decoration:none;cursor:default}
#checkit{float:right;margin:2px 0 2px 2px}
#TB_window{font:12px Arial, Helvetica, sans-serif;position:fixed;background:#fff;z-index:102;color:#000;display:none;border:4px solid #525252;text-align:left;top:50%;left:50%;margin:0;padding:0}
#TB_secondLine{font:10px Arial, Helvetica, sans-serif;color:#666}
#TB_overlay{position:fixed;z-index:100;top:0;left:0;height:100%;width:100%}
.TB_overlayMacFFBGHack{background:url(macFFBgHack.png) repeat}
.TB_overlayBG{background-color:#000;filter:alpha(opacity=75);-moz-opacity:0.75;opacity:0.75}
#TB_window img#TB_Image{display:block;border-right:1px solid #ccc;border-bottom:1px solid #ccc;border-top:1px solid #666;border-left:1px solid #666;margin:15px 0 0 15px}
#TB_caption{height:25px;float:left;padding:7px 30px 10px 25px}
#TB_closeWindow{height:25px;float:right;padding:11px 25px 10px 0}
#TB_closeAjaxWindow{margin-bottom:1px;text-align:right;float:right;padding:7px 10px 5px 0}
#TB_ajaxWindowTitle{float:left;margin-bottom:1px;padding:7px 0 5px 10px}
#TB_title{background-color:#e8e8e8;height:27px}
#TB_ajaxContent{clear:both;overflow:auto;text-align:left;line-height:1.4em;padding:2px 15px 15px}
#TB_ajaxContent.TB_modal{padding:15px}
#TB_ajaxContent p{padding:5px 0}
#TB_load{position:fixed;display:none;height:13px;width:208px;z-index:103;top:50%;left:50%;margin:-6px 0 0 -104px}
#TB_HideSelect{z-index:99;position:fixed;top:0;left:0;background-color:#fff;border:none;filter:alpha(opacity=0);-moz-opacity:0;opacity:0;height:100%;width:100%}
#TB_iframeContent{clear:both;border:none;margin-bottom:-1px;margin-top:1px;_margin-bottom:1px}
.list_item li{background:url(images/TPdivider.gif) no-repeat 0 8px;padding:5px 0 6px 12px}
#fadeSubmit{background:url(images/loader.gif) no-repeat scroll -999px -9999px transparent}
#index_full{width:785px;color:#444}
#index_full h2{font-size:1.4em;margin:0;padding:1em 1em 4px}
#index_full ul.list_item li{padding:2px 0 4px 12px}
#welcome{width:55%;float:left;background:url(images/welcome-bg.png) no-repeat 100% 100%}
#welcome p{line-height:1.6;color:#888;font-size:120%;padding:10px 7em 10px 25px}
#welcome div.frame{width:90%;height:250px;background:url(images/firdaus-shayari.png) no-repeat 102% 50%}
#latest_topics{float:right;width:45%;margin-left:0;background:#eee;border-radius:15px 15px 0 0;-moz-border-radius:15px 15px 0 0;-webkit-border-radius:15px 15px 0 0;min-height:250px}
.index_topics{background:#eee;overflow:hidden;border-radius:15px 0 15px 15px;-moz-border-radius:15px 0 15px 15px;-webkit-border-radius:15px 0 15px 15px}
.idbg{border-radius:14px;-moz-border-radius:14px;-webkit-border-radius:14px;border:1px solid #cfcfcf;background:url(images/cat-bg.png) repeat-x 0 -10px #EFEFEF;margin:8px 10px 2px}
.idbg h3{background:url(images/sprites.png) no-repeat 7px -131px;font-size:100%;margin:0;padding:6px 10px 6px 28px}
#tip_box{float:right;width:48%;color:#777;margin:5px}
#tip_box div.frame{padding-left:16px}
.tip_title{font-size:110%;font-weight:700;padding:0 0 6px 4px}
.tip_inner{background:#fff;-webkit-border-radius:8px;-moz-border-radius:8px;border-radius:8px;box-shadow:0 0 11px #BBB inset;overflow:hidden;padding:20px}
.t_body_wrapper{background:#fff;overflow:hidden;box-shadow:1px 1px 3px #aaa;-webkit-box-shadow:1px 1px 3px #aaa;-moz-box-shadow:1px 1px 3px #aaa;margin:1.2em}
.index_thumb{border:1px solid #999;box-shadow:2px 2px 10px #AAA;-moz-box-shadow:2px 2px 10px #AAA;-webkit-box-shadow:2px 2px 10px #AAA;float:right;min-width:120px;margin:2em}
.index_thumb img{padding:2px}
.round_sm{border-radius:10px;-moz-border-radius:10px;-webkit-border-radius:10px}
.round_bg{border-radius:20px;-moz-border-radius:20px;-webkit-border-radius:20px}
.topic_body{width:76%;position:relative;overflow:hidden;float:left;margin-bottom:4px}
.topic_msg{padding:20px 15px 15px}
.index_topic_author{position:absolute;right:32px;top:37px;background:#eee;font-size:95%;box-shadow:1px 1px 1px #ccc;-moz-box-shadow:1px 1px 1px #ccc;-webkit-box-shadow:1px 1px 1px #ccc;border-radius:0 0 10px 10px;-moz-border-radius:0 0 10px 10px;-webkit-border-radius:0 0 10px 10px;padding:2px 6px}
.index_topic_meta{width:70%;float:right}
.index_topic_meta ul li{float:left;box-shadow:1px 1px 1px #ccc;-moz-box-shadow:1px 1px 1px #ccc;-webkit-box-shadow:1px 1px 1px #ccc;border-radius:10px;-moz-border-radius:10px;-webkit-border-radius:10px;font-size:95%;margin:2px 5px;padding:2px 8px}
#imp_info{width:50%;float:left}
#imp_info span{font-weight:700}
#topbar{text-align:center;position:absolute;background-color:brown;width:500px;visibility:hidden;z-index:100;box-shadow:0 0 4px #bfbfbf;padding:2px}
.stats-high{font-size:130%;letter-spacing:2px}
.guest-hover{color:#fff;display:block;font-weight:700;padding:5px;background:url("images/sprites.png") no-repeat 27px -18px}
#topbar a:hover{background:url("images/sprites.png") no-repeat 9px -131px #FF7A00;color:#fff;display:block}
#latest_discussion li{padding:20px 10px}
.social_icon li{float:left;margin:10px}
a.social_icon{width:43px;height:42px;display:block;background:url(images/sprites.png) no-repeat}
a:link.youtube,a:visited.youtube{background-position:0 -55px}
a:link.facebook,a:visited.facebook{background-position:0 -211px}
a:link.twitter,a:visited.twitter{background-position:0 -164px}
a:link.metronome,a:visited.metronome{background-position:0 -220px}
a:link.gplus,a:visited.gplus{background-position:0 -258px}
a:hover.gplus,a:hover.youtube,a:hover.facebook,a:hover.twitter,a:hover.metronome{opacity:.6;filter:alpha(opacity=60)}
.floatr,* html #shadow-r,.floatright{float:right}
.floatl,* html #shadow-l,.social_icon{float:left}
#showcase ul,.reset{list-style:none;margin:0;padding:0}
#footer a:hover,#TB_window a:hover{color:#000}
.clr,.clear{clear:both}
#TB_window a:link,#TB_window a:visited,#TB_window a:active,#TB_window a:focus{color:#666}
* html #TB_overlay,* html #TB_HideSelect{position:absolute;height:expression(document.body.scrollHeight>document.body.offsetHeight?document.body.scrollHeight:document.body.offsetHeight+'px')}
* html #TB_window,* html #TB_load{position:absolute;margin-top:expression(0-parseInt(this.offsetHeight/2) 0 (TBWindowMargin=document.documentElement&&document.documentElement.scrollTop||document.body.scrollTop) 0 px)}
#latest_topics div.frame,#imp_info div.frame{padding:2px 10px 5px 20px}
.center {text-align: center}
.social li{float:left;margin:2px 4px}